India proudly hosts its first-ever Formula One Championship at this gigantic venue. The Buddh International Circuit, just 24 km from New Delhi is capable of accommodating nearly over 1,20,000 international fans of the glitzy event. The 5.141 kilometre track has spread across an area of 875 acres. The F1 speed cars will rapidly lap through 16 largely medium speed corners of the track 60 times thus covering the total distance of about 308.4 kilometres.
The practice events were organized on 28th and 29th of October and the exciting final race fires the tracks of Noida by 3 pm on Sunday, the 30th of October 2011.


The 12 teams participating in this thrilling championship 2011 are Red Bull-Renault, McLaren-Mercedes, Ferrari, Mercedes, Renault, Williams-Cosworth, ForceIndia-Mercedes, Sauber-Ferrari, Toro Rosso-Ferrari, Lotus-Renault, HRT-Cosworth and Virgin-Cosworth.
